mysql blocked because of many connection errors; 重置
时间: 2024-06-15 15:04:42 浏览: 11
当MySQL出现"blocked because of many connection errors"错误时,这通常是由于连接错误次数过多导致的。MySQL服务器会限制某个IP地址的连接请求,以保护服务器免受恶意攻击或错误配置的影响。
要解决这个问题,可以尝试以下方法:
1. 检查连接错误:首先,需要确定连接错误的原因。可以查看MySQL的错误日志文件,通常位于服务器的/var/log/mysql/目录下。查找与连接错误相关的错误消息,以了解具体的问题。
2. 修复连接错误:根据错误消息,修复导致连接错误的问题。可能是由于错误的用户名或密码、错误的主机名或端口号、网络问题等引起的。确保使用正确的连接参数进行连接。
3. 增加最大连接数:如果连接错误是由于并发连接数过多导致的,可以尝试增加MySQL服务器的最大连接数。可以通过修改MySQL配置文件(通常是/etc/mysql/my.cnf)中的max_connections参数来增加最大连接数。将该值适当增大,然后重启MySQL服务。
4. 优化应用程序:检查应用程序代码,确保在使用完数据库连接后及时释放连接资源。避免长时间占用连接而不使用。
5. 使用连接池:考虑使用连接池来管理数据库连接。连接池可以有效地管理和复用数据库连接,减少连接错误的发生。
相关问题
blocked because of many connection errors;
"blocked because of many connection errors"是指由于多次连接错误而被阻止访问某个网站或服务器。这通常是由于网络连接问题、服务器故障或防火墙设置等原因引起的。当系统检测到多次连接错误时,为了保护服务器和网络的安全性,会自动阻止进一步的连接尝试。
如果您遇到了这个问题,您可以尝试以下解决方法:
1. 检查您的网络连接:确保您的网络连接正常,并且没有任何问题,例如断开连接或不稳定的信号。
2. 清除浏览器缓存:有时候浏览器缓存可能会导致连接错误。尝试清除浏览器缓存并重新加载网页。
3. 重启路由器或调整网络设置:如果问题仍然存在,尝试重启您的路由器或调整网络设置,以确保网络连接正常。
4. 联系网站管理员:如果您仍然无法解决问题,建议您联系网站管理员或技术支持团队,向他们报告问题并寻求帮助。
host is blocked because of many connection errors
根据引用\[1\]和引用\[2\]的内容,报错"Host is blocked because of many connection errors"是因为在短时间内同一个IP产生了太多中断的数据库连接,导致被阻塞。解决这个问题的方法有两种:
1. 提高允许的max_connection_errors数量:可以通过修改max_connection_errors的值来增加允许的错误连接数量。可以使用以下命令查看当前的max_connection_errors值:`show variables like '%max_connection_errors%';`,然后使用以下命令将其修改为较大的值,例如1000:`set global max_connect_errors = 1000;`。如果需要重启后仍然生效,可以在my.cnf配置文件中的\[mysqld\]下添加`max_connect_errors = 1000`。
2. 重置错误记录数:可以使用以下命令来重置错误记录数:`flush hosts;`或者`mysqladmin flush-hosts -h 127.0.0.1 -uroot -p`。
需要注意的是,根据业务需要设置max_connection_errors的值,不是越大越好,过大的值可能会降低安全性。默认情况下,MySQL的max_connection_errors值为10。
#### 引用[.reference_title]
- *1* [应用连MySQL 报错ERROR 1129 Host is blocked because of many connection errors](https://blog.csdn.net/Hehuyi_In/article/details/111595351)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v91^control,239^v3^insert_chatgpt"}} ] [.reference_item]
- *2* [mysql “Host is blocked because of many connection errors”](https://blog.csdn.net/m0_37312111/article/details/78717314)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v91^control,239^v3^insert_chatgpt"}} ] [.reference_item]
[ .reference_list ]
相关推荐
![rar](https://img-home.csdnimg.cn/images/20210720083606.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)